What is the cheapest Chicago to Oranjestad flight route?

Data is based on round-trip flight searches on KAYAK over the past month.

The cheapest return flight from Chicago to Oranjestad costs $530 on the route between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port (ORD) and Oranjestad (AUA). It is also the most popular route.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Chicago to Oranjestad?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Chicago to Oranjestad cl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from Chicago to Oranjestad, you should consider leaving on a Tuesday and avoid Fridays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Chicago, you’ll find the best rates on Fridays and the most expensive ones on Thursdays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Chicago to Oranjestad?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ago to Oranjestad,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Chicago to Oranjestad is August, where tickets cost $635 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and March,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$959 and $840 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Chicago to Oranjestad?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ago to Oranjestad,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Chicago to Oranjestad, you should book around 4 weeks before departure, which saves you about 44%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 4 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Chicago to Oranjestad

  • What is the cheapest flight from Chicago to Oranjestad?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Chicago to Oranjestad was $142 for a one-way ticket and $488 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Chicago and Oranjestad?

    Yes, you'll most likely have to show a valid passport before boarding the plane in Chicago and on arrival in Oranjestad.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Chicago to Oranjestad?

    When flying out of Chicago you will be using one of these airports: Chicago Midway or Chicago O'Hare Intl. You will be landing at Oranjestad Reina Beatrix.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Chicago to Oranjestad?

    Only American Airlines offers inflight Wi-Fi service on the Chicago to Oranjestad fl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Chicago to Oranjestad?

    The Boeing 737-900 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Chicago to Oranjestad fl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Chicago to Oranjestad?

    Star Alliance, oneworld, and SkyTeam are the airline alliances operating flights between Chicago and Oranjestad, with Star Alliance being the most commonly used for this route.

  • What is the most popular layover when flying to Oranjestad from Chicago?

    Charlotte is the most popular layover city among KAYAK users traveling from Chicago to Oranjestad.
